meson: prepare move of QEMU_CFLAGS to meson
Clean up the handling of compiler flags in meson.build, splitting
the general flags that should be included in subprojects as well,
from warning flags that only apply to QEMU itself. The two were
mixed in both configure tests and meson tests.
This split makes it easier to move the compiler tests piecewise
from configure to Meson.
